在地图中获取mysql数据,并在拖动半径时更改数据
fetch mysql data in map with data change on dragging radius
我想创建与中给出的相同的映射https://housing.com/in/rent/search?f=eyJsb2N0IjoiZXN0IiwiZXN0Ijp7ImlkIjoiMTk5MzYyIiwicmFkaXVzIjo2NTN9fQ%3D%3D但我无法从数据库中获得数据,该数据库将具有给定中心周围的所有点,该中心将在拖动地图的半径时发生变化
我认为最容易理解的方法是首先计算圆心和点之间的距离。我会使用这个公式:
d = sqrt((circle_x - x)^2 + (circle_y - y)^2)
然后,简单地将该公式的结果,即距离(d
)与半径进行比较。如果距离(d
)小于或等于半径(r
),则该点位于圆内(如果d
和r
相等,则位于圆的边缘)。
SELECT load_detail_id,s_city,s_latitude,d_latitude、s_经度、d_经度,3956*2*ASIN(SQRT(POWER(SIN(($s_latitude-abs(dest.s_alatitude))*pi()/180/2),2)+COS$半径
相关文章:
- 调整窗口大小时,可拖动的对象会出现在容器外部
- 删除对HTML元素的拖动
- jQuery UI可排序-多连接列表拖动
- 禁用SVG拖动
- 旋转后拖动对象
- JQuery UI可拖动潜水与滚动棒到鼠标
- jsPlumb-拖动克隆而不进行复制
- 当我在节点上拖动鼠标时,我如何防止使用d3.ehavior.zoom().on(“缩放”,重绘)
- 纸张.js路径数据动画在帧和鼠标拖动
- 在画布上拖动和绘制时传输图像数据
- 从拖动元素中获取 HTML5 自定义数据属性
- 如何在购物车中拖动新数据后从购物车中删除旧数据
- 用光标拖动使d3.js数据图旋转
- 在地图中获取mysql数据,并在拖动半径时更改数据
- 如何拖动数据(在uri格式)从浏览器到其他应用程序
- jquery可拖动停止可以停止对象属性数据-*
- 如何使用鼠标拖动选项在jQuery数据表中选择多行
- 在D3中更新带有过渡的数据后更新拖动/滚动原点
- 如何防止这两个多维数据集同时被拖动
- D3, JSON,图形,强制布局,数据更新,未完成重绘,拖动